Frequently Asked Questions
1. What are rare girl names that start with D?
There are several rare girl names that start with D. For example, Delphine (‘of Delphi’), Devora (‘bee’), Dita (a diminutive of names ending with -dita like Judita or starting with Diet- like Dietlinde), and Drusilla (‘strong’) are rare and unique.
2. What are some of the most popular names starting with D for girls?
Names like Daisy (‘the white flower,’ ‘day eye’), Dakota (‘allies’ or ‘friends’), Delilah (‘delicate’), Diana (‘goddess’), Dominique (‘of the Lord’), and Drew ( short form of Andrew, which means ‘masculine’) are some of the most popular names for girls that start with D. These names have consistently shown good performance over the years and have been popular choices among new parents.
3. Which baby girl names that start with D are inspired by nature?
Dahlia (name of a flower named after the Swedish botanist Anders Dahl), Daisy (a white flower, meaning ‘day eye’), Dawn (derived from the English word dawn and the Old English dagung, meaning the time of the day close to sunrise), Dove (derived from the English word for the bird usually used as a sign of peace), Devora (biblical name, meaning ‘bee’), and Daphne (‘laurel tree’) are inspired by nature.
4. What are some baby girl names that start with D with strong meanings?
Certain baby girl names like Diana (‘goddess’), Delia (an epithet of the Greek goddess of the moon and hunting, Artemis), Danica (‘morning star,’ ‘Venus’), Demeter (‘earth mother’), Devi (‘mother goddess’), and Durga (‘unattainable,’ name of a Hindu warrior goddess) are names that mean strong or convey the sense of strength.
